Deadpool recently wished Cable actor Josh Brolin a happy birthday with a hilarious Goonies-inspired painting, and now the time-travelling mutant badass has returned the favor with a masterpiece of his own.

To celebrate Josh Brolin's birthday earlier this week, the official Deadpool movie Twitter account debuted a hilarious image of The Merc With a Mouth painting Cable as Brolin's character from The Goonies.

Now, the surly time-hopper has fired back with a painting of his own.

We're not sure where this originated from (we assume it's fan-made), but the image sees Cable depicting Wade as "Weapon XI", a.k.a. Ryan Reynolds bastardized incarnation of Deadpool from the much-maligned X-Men Origins: Wolverine.

Is this the end of it, or can we expect something else from The Merc? Deadpool 2 hits theaters this May.
